I've been thinking about using investment as a means to increase funds available for conservation. Eg, set up land trusts in which people can own and resell units of land under conservation covenants. My reservation is that given global warming, resource depletion, population expansion it can only be seen as an extremely high risk investment. Would this be an ethical thing to do? I wouldn't want to be the Madoff of private reserves.

What do you think?
